Talking about LOVE in the context of the story of David and Goliath may sound absurd, but the truth is that the motivation for David’s willingness to fight Goliath was his heartfelt love for the God he knew. There are two opposing “forces” in this world: Good and Evil. We know that God is good and Satan and his “minions” are evil. You cannot be “on the fence” when it comes to loving and serving God! God tells His people to hate what is evil and cling to what is good. Loving God, therefore, means hating evil, wherever you see it, and standing firm against those who oppose both God and His people, His kingdom. David fought Goliath, not to make a name for himself, but to defend the honor of his God!  God’s people today face “giants” all the time in the form of suffering and trials and persecution. Too often we imagine ourselves being “picked on,” or even punished.  “Why ME?” people cry! Few run into the battle, seeing an opportunity to glorify God by trusting in His grace and strength, and using the gifts and abilities HE has given to overcome the enemies of God’s people that come in many forms. Yet, this is our calling!! There is a “moral” to this story … a lesson to be learned that can turn your life from victim to victor. And it has to do with realizing that “love is a two-way street!”
